We gotta talk!! These 5 myths I hear all the time and the are so so false! Starting with: 1. PMS is just part of being a woman! WRONG! PMS is common but not normal. We are taught from such a young age that our periods are painful and we just have to put up with it. Your period should consist of light symptoms that donāt really disrupt your life. If you have symptoms that are more than that, this is your bodies way of saying something is wrong! 2. Gut health has nothing to do with hormones. WRONG! There is a colony of bacteria called the estrobolome that are responsible for metabolizing and excreting estrogen. This plays a huge role in estrogen balance and therefore your cycle. 3. Birth control balances your hormones. WRONG! What birth control does is stops your natural production of hormones and replaces them with synthetic ones. So yes, your symptoms go away but can causes so many other issues. 4. Fat makes you fat. WRONG! Fat is an essential building block to creating hormones in your body. You need fat to survive and keep regular hormone balance. 5. Stress only affects your mood. WRONG! Chronic stress does so much damage to the body. It can suppress your natural hormone production because you are in a state of fight or flight. This can throw off your hormone balance. Which myth did you believe?? Donāt complicate it! Homemade cashew milk for diversity because this nutritionist usually drinks soy milk. Diversity ensures we get lots of different nutrients, plus it helps with gut health. So many benefits to keeping raw cashews on hand. No more running out to the store to buy milk when itās pouring rain and youāre cozy at home. Itās affordable in todayās economy and uses less packaging waste. š„³ Itās so easy, creamy and customizable. With me getting sick recently, Iām being extra cautious so Iād soak cashews overnight in the fridge. 1. Soak 1 cup cashews overnight in water 2. Rinse well 3. Add to high powered blender with filtered water 4. I add true cinnamon and a pinch of salt 5. Option to add a couple dates for sweetness Blend well and thatās it! Are you still breaking out months after stopping birth control?? šø Hereās why your acne wonāt go away and some suggestions on how to help it!š§š§“⨠First off, the pill never fixed your acne! It worked by masking your natural hormones so when you come off, your bodyās trying to relearn how to make hormones again! Especially testosterone and estrogen. š± Focus on your liver! Your liver is your bodyās natural detox organ so if you have a slow liver or nutrient deficiencies this can slow down your liver production which leads to toxins not being eliminated properly which you guessed it, leads to acne! Eat liver boosting foods like: ⢠beets š«š«š« ⢠antioxidant rich fruits and veggies like blueberries, citrus fruits and bell peppers š«šš« ⢠tons of cruciferous vegetables š„¦ š„Focus on your gut health! If you donāt have a healthy gut, this can impact how you metabolize estrogen and can lead to higher levels of estrogen in the body then you want! Eat a whole foods diet and balance your blood sugar! You can add in fermented foods but if you are having GI issues you might need to get some testing done before you add in fermented foods! šNutrient depletions can make a big impact when you are trying to heal your hormones and your acne. Birth control depletes B vitamins, zinc and magnesium which are crucial to your health and liver health. WHY YOU SHOULD EAT OATS & FRUIT Oatmeal: research shows beta-glucan in oats has possible cholesterol lowering and anti diabetic effects. Cardiovascular disease & type 2 diabetes are the top disease and mortality burdens worldwide. Grains are high in fibre which the gut microbiome thrives on. Good bacteria help digest food, support immunity and lower inflammation. I can always tell when people eat grain free when I see their GI-MAP because they have such low commensal bacteria. Consumption of oats significantly increased Akkermansia muciniphila & Roseburia bacteria. Oats are a great prebiotic food to help feed your good bacteria so eat up. I like steel cut for a bowl of oats and old fashion in baking. PMID 34828872 34444718 344956218 FRUIT: I find it odd people avoid fruit, but drink sugary alcohol or drink pop. Sorry, but fruit is loaded with benefits from fibre to vitamins and polyphenols (maybe youāve heard of anthocyanins?). Polyphenols have antioxidant & anti-inflammatory properties. Fruit help prevent constipation, IBS, IBD, reduce the risk of cardiovascular disease, type 2 diabetes, lowering the risk of depression, supports higher bone density & more. Whole fruits are ideal versus juice due to delayed gastric emptying (thanks fibre!). Donāt fear sugar in fruit! PMID 28983192 30487459 Plants contain polyphenols and fibre to feed your microbiome and reduce inflammation.
